Invisalign treatment involves the use of discreet, clear, plastic aligners that fit comfortably around the teeth. It can be used to correct any problem where teeth aren’t in the correct position, including but not limited to:

  • Crowding where there isn’t enough space for your teeth

  • Spacing where there are gaps between your teeth

  • Problems with the way teeth bite such as crossbites, deep bites and open bites

  • Before treatment with dental implants or before cosmetic treatments such as veneers or composite bonding to get the teeth in the best position first to allow the best results

Invisalign is a hugely popular treatment worldwide due to the fantastic results and transformations it can achieve for people. The advantages compared to fixed braces are that the aligners can be removed for eating and cleaning your teeth and that they are smooth so there is minimal irritation of the lips and cheeks. The aligners come in a series that are changed every 1-2 weeks to gently move the teeth into position. We will see you for an appointment every 4-6 weeks to monitor your treatment. Aligners need to be  worn for 21-22 hours per day to be effective.


At the Willows we use digital scanners to avoid patients needing messy and uncomfortable
impressions and ensure very accurate fitting aligners. Before you commit yourself to Invisalign treatment we will show you a 3D simulation of your treatment, which will help to accurately predict the treatment time, as well as showing the final appearance of your new smile.


Treatment length varies depending on the complexity of the case but can be as little as 3 months and is typically 6-9 months. Our clinicians are skilled in supplementary treatments such as tooth whitening and composite bonding if it is required to enhance the end result. It is important that all patients wear retainers after treatment to prevent teeth from moving back.
